Hawking statue unveiled
A statue of Stephen Hawking is being unveiled at the opening of Cambridge University's new Centre for Theoretical Cosmology. Professor Hawking will attend the inauguration of the facility, which will focus on investigating theories about the formation and development of the universe. The event coincides with the 25th anniversary of a landmark Cambridge conference which shaped the world's understanding of the universe. The 'Very Early Universe' workshop organised by Professor Hawking at the University in 1982 revolutionised thinking about the big bang, fourteen billion years ago. The Statue, by the late artist Ian Walters, is the last public work by the artist who famously produced the nine foot image of Nelson Mandela that stands in Parliament Square. Despite suffering from debilitating amyotrophic lateral sclerosis, Hawking has become one of the world's greatest experts on gravity and black holes, places where matter is compressed to the point where the normal laws of space and time break down. Hawking linked gravity and quantum theory, and made the startling discovery that under certain conditions black holes can emit sub-atomic particles. Until that point it had been assumed that absolutely nothing, not even light, could escape from a black hole. The particles emitted by an evaporating black hole became known as Hawking Radiation. For someone for whom communication is so difficult - he can only speak via a speech synthesiser - Prof Hawking is a great believer in communicating science to the public.
